Hook, Ernest B. (Editor)
Description The papers in this volume discuss the notion of “premature” scientific discoveries posed by molecular biologist Gunther Stent in 1972. They were initiated by the question: “why are some discoveries rejected at a particular time but later seen to be valid?” Relevant papers are listed separately. Contributors include: Carpenter, Kenneth J., Comfort, Nathaniel, Gerson, Elihu, Ghiselin, Michael, Glen, William, Hetherington, Norriss S., Holmes, Frederic L., Hook, Ernest B., Hull, David, Jones, Martin, Löwy, Ilana, Motulsky, Arno G., Munévar, Gonzalo, Nye, Mary Jo, Ruse, Michael, Sacks, Oliver, Seaborg, Glenn T., Stent, Gunther S., Stern, Lawrence, Townes, Charles H., Muhll, George Von der, Zinder, Norton.
